Timer 
The timer can be set from 1 to 60 minutes. The default timer 
setting is 10 minutes.
To use the timer:
1. Press the Timer button to enter the timer mode. After 
5 seconds the default time will be automatically selected.
2. Press the Power Decrease and Power Increase buttons while 
the display is flashing (5 seconds) to adjust to the desired 
time. Pressing the timer button again or waiting 5 seconds 
after selecting the desired time will start the timer countdown.
3. The timer can be canceled at any time by pressing the Timer 
button again.  
NOTE: During the timer setup, the Power Decrease and Power 
Increase buttons are dedicated to the timer. After the timer starts, 
the Power Decrease and Power Increase buttons can be used for 
other functions.
Fan Speed
Power Increase/On
This button is used to turn the fan On or increase the fan speed.
The fan will turn On if the Power Increase button is pressed 
and the hood was Off.
An audible tone will sound when the fan reaches its highest 
speed.
Power Decrease/Off
This button is used to turn the fan Off or to decrease the fan 
speed.
Timed Fan Off
The control has a “Timed Fan Off” feature. When activated, it 
automatically turns the blower fan off after 10 minutes.
Press and hold the Timer button for 5 seconds to activate. 
The fan icon will flash and 10:00 (10 minutes) will show in the 
display. The time will start counting down after 3 seconds.
RANGE HOOD CARE
Cleaning
IMPORTANT: Clean the hood and grease filters frequently 
according to the following instructions. Replace grease filters 
before operating hood.
Exterior Surfaces:
To avoid damage to the exterior surface, do not use steel wool or 
soap-filled scouring pads. 
Always wipe dry to avoid water marks.
Cleaning Method:
Liquid detergent soap and water, or all-purpose cleanser
Wipe with damp soft cloth or nonabrasive sponge, then rinse 
with clean water and wipe dry.
Metal Grease Filter
The filters should be washed frequently. Place metal filters in 
dishwasher or hot detergent solution to clean.
Let filter dry thoroughly before replacing it.
Turn off fan and lights. Allow halogen lamp to cool.
1. Remove each filter by pulling the spring release handle and 
then pulling down the filter.
2. Wash metal filters as needed in dishwasher or hot detergent 
solution.
3. Reinstall the filter by making sure the spring release handles 
are toward the front. Insert metal grease filter into upper 
track.
4. Pull the spring release handle down.
5. Push up on metal filter and release handle to latch into place.
6. Repeat steps 1-5 for the other filter.
